STAMENKOVSKI: WE WILL NEVER CLOSE THE DOOR TO OUR BROTHERS AND SISTERS FROM SRPSKA

VIŠEGRAD, JUNE 7 /SRNA/ - Serbia will never abandon Republika Srpska, and will never close the door to our brothers and sisters, Serbia's Minister of Family, Youth and Sports, Milica Đurđević Stamenkovski, said today in Andrićgrad.
At the event “Encounters on the Drina – Bridges of Serbian Unity” in Andrićgrad, Stamenkovski emphasized that it is a great honor to stand on land where every stone bears witness to the endurance of the Serbian people. "Today’s gathering is more than a brotherly embrace – it is a symbol of our determination to be a bridge, a support, and a source of strength for one another. It affirms our resolve to stand united, to preserve Serbian unity, and to regard Serbia and Republika Srpska as one family," Stamenkovski emphasized. She recalled that the All-Serbian Assembly was held a year ago, and that the Declaration adopted at that time opened the door to cooperation, stressing that they are here today to send a message that the continuity of those decisions endures. "President Dodik, the verdict delivered against you was actually directed at Republika Srpska, which we rejected and sent a message that we will never give up on our vision," Stamenkovski emphasized. She added that Serbia will always care about the survival and independence of the Serbian people in Republika Srpska. “The vision for the 21st century is peace, freedom, prosperity, social justice, and spiritual and demographic renewal,” she said, emphasizing that Serbs do not want others to shape their identity. “We do not fear the darkness; we will never bow our heads. A new dawn will come for those who have not forgotten who they are and have preserved their roots. Serbs have always stood firm in the hardest of times. Our unity is the light that will dispel fear. May the unity of our people on both sides of the Drina River be eternal, like the Sun,” Stamenkovski said. This event marks the first anniversary of the All-Serbian Assembly and the signing of the Declaration on the Protection of the National and Political Rights and the Shared Future of the Serbian People. The event is jointly organized by the governments of Republika Srpska and Serbia as a symbol of the ties between the Serbian people on both sides of the Drina River.
